A1 Martín-González, Juan José K1 Adaptaciones cinematográficas K1 Folklore urbano AB This chapter is aimed at examining two neo-Victorian adaptations of the legend of SweeneyTodd: Stephen Sondheim’s Sweeney Todd. The Demon Barber of Fleet Street. A MusicalThriller (1979) and Tim Burton’s Sweeney Todd, the Demon Barber of Fleet Street (2007).Firstly, taking the analytical tenets of Adaptation theories as a point of departure, I willconsider the medium-specific features of theatre and cinema that come out in the play and thefilm referred above respectively. Secondly, I will look into how violence is portrayed in eachadaptation and I will peruse the social-political resonances of the legend in general by tracingbriefly its adaptation evolution from the nineteenth century up to nowadays.
